Distanza tra curve

ciao
premetto che questo problema è la prima volta che mi capita, non ho fatto molte cose con crea superficie da rete di curve ma comunque non ho avuto problemi fino a oggi, insomma modificando le curve, collegate da punto a punto di altre due curve, succede che Gumball distanzia i punti di collegamento di cui sopra, quindi la superficie da rete di curve non c’è verso di crearla, mi sono sbattezzato un po’ per capire ma alla fine dipende da questo, i punti si distanziano di pochissimo ma questo è sufficiente a mandare nel casino tutto, domanda:
c’è un modo per tenere collegati i punti delle estremità che inizialmente sono collegati alle altre curve?
Max
allego foto per maggior chiarezza (spero)

Ciao Massimo allega il file così capiamo meglio :wink:

lo avevo allegato ma ne ho fatto uno più esplicito di esempio che forse, se non c’è attualmente modo, potrebbe essere un suggerimento per gli sviluppatori


si può vedere una curva ricostruita a piacimento e un’altra ancora da modificare, da questo momento bisognerebbe avere la possibilità di bloccare le estremità della curva collegata alle altre due, in modo che una volta modificata non si corra il rischio (anzi certezza) che questi punti vengano allontanati dalla loro origine.
vediamo che mi dicono.

…“O Tosco che per la città del foco vivo ten vai così parlando onesto…”

Non ho capito una beata fava…
Allega sto file Massimino!!!

Com’io al piè de la sua tomba fui,guardommi un poco, e poi, quasi sdegnoso, mi dimandò: "Qual versione di Rhino usasti? :joy:

maremma maiala…o sono proprio fuori o non volete capire, vediamo se riesco a chiarire questo problema riscontrato, allora: per farla proprio semplice come il file che ho già allegato, tiro due linee (si lo so curve) le collego tra loro, perpendicolarmente o meno, con altre curve, da una all’altra, sulla foto che ho allegato prima si vede chiaramente, poi “invoco” il comando “ricostruisci curve”, ci siamo fino a qui spero. Modifico 'ste benedette curve mettendemi su prospettica (già sotto accusa), e con Gumball lavoro sui punti della curva per modificarla, mi segui? faccio così n volte per creare una forma ovvio, poi voglio costruire una superficie con questo bel lavoro che ho fatto :slight_smile: e utilizzo il comando superfici>rete di curve, va bene? (si perché l’ho fatto altre volte e funzionava forse perché la modifica delle curve non era poi eccessiva, forse!?).
Ebbene caro Giuseppe, niente da fare, il lavoro è andato a farsi f… e sai perchjiieéé?
i punti di ancoraggio tra le linee sono andati a farsi benedire (forse il fondale ha poca tenuta :wink: ) infatti il comando superfici da rete di curve non può funzionare poverino, mica sono collegate, anche di pochissimo ma sono distanti, tutto questo mi sembrava fosse già esaurientemente spiegato nel post precedente, attenzione attenzione, naturalmente in queste condizioni non funziona nessun comando per le superfici.
naturalmente i due punti all’estremità non vengono assolutamente toccati, vorrei fosse chiaro.
adesso mettici una pezza! o dammi dell’imbecille.

ciao
M

Massimo, mi stai mandando in confusione.
Quando ti si chiede di allegare il file si intende il 3dm, non un’immagine.
Se non ho capito male vorresti che modificando delle curve tutto quello che ci hai disegnato “sopra” si adattasse di conseguenza.
No bbuono, Rhino non funziona così a meno che quello che hai disegnato “sopra” sia stato fatto con comandi che supportano il registra storia e che il registra storia sia stato attivato.
La rete di curve di solito digerisce tutto, la regola è che le curve di una direzione intersechino quelle nell’altra ma la la regola si può infrangere bellamente, accettando le approssimazioni del caso…
Se il comando non funziona probabilmente è perché Rhino non è (ancora) mago.
Fabio.

sono basito, ma davvero parlo arabo?
guardate quello schizzo che ho allegato e leggete altrimenti staremo qui fino al 2049, non vedete che c’è una curva evidenziata con i due punti all’estremità accesi? e poi c’è scritto: blocca punto, questo sarebbe un augurio che mi faccio sperando che uno sviluppatore possa creare un comando apposito.
semplicemente vorrei sapere perché se modifico una curva che ne collega altre due, e senza toccare i punti di intersezione, ma solo quelli centrali quanti essi siano 2,3,4,8,12,48 quelli che siano, non cambino, cioè che non mollino l’intersezione, perchè questo allontanamento dovuto allo “stiramento” degli altri punti della curva compromette la rete necessaria a creare la superficie.

Massimo ti consiglierei di studiare un po’ le nurbs, credo che poi dubbi del genere non ti verranno più.
L’intersezione delle curve è un fatto accidentale, le hai disegnate così, ma non si sono mica fuse in una qualche logica, se una la sposti o la modifichi l’altra riamane dove è, semplice … o no?
Fabio.

PointsOn sulla curva 'traversa’
Poi muovi/trascini l’ultimo/primo CV fino a snappare sulla ‘curva-laterale’

OK, va fatto a mano, ma credo che si potrebbe anche scriptare. Non l’adattamento automatico,
ma il fatto di riportare, dopo le modifiche,le curve traverse a toccare le curve laterali, lanciando uno script e selezionando le curve … almeno questa e’ la prima impressione

… Il tutto fino a quando Rhino non si convincera’ a diventare parametrico. :wink:

1 Mi Piace

santo cielo, Gambler è chiaro che trascinando, modificando, i punti di una curva questa si allontana dall’altra, ma siamo qui proprio a discutere di questo no?
io mi chiedevo se c’è un modo, come dire, per ancorare il punto di intersezione in modo che questo non si sposti mai anche se “stiri” la curva all’infinito, questo sarebbe un vantaggio non indifferente lo capisci?

La risposta è NO.
Hai letto quello che ti abbiamo scritto?
Rhino non supporta di suo queste “operazioni”, ci puoi arrivare con degli script, con Grasshopper ma “solo” con Rhino no a patto di non usare comandi dei quali ti ho già scritto.

Ci provo. :roll_eyes:

Si Don Massimo… ti seguo
…e ti vedo come se mi arrivi a un incrocio mure a sinistra…:wink:

La vista prospettiva è la più infida a modificare i punti con il gumball perchè in base alla posizione dell’ osservatore la traslazione puà avvenire su piani diversi portandoti così a spasso nello spazio 3D. Ovviamente, se ti trovi bene così… mi taccio.
Se modifichi una curva trascinando un punto di controllo interno (non iniziale e non finale) non controlli più per dove passa la curva. Ci sono altri modi per risolvere questo tipo di problema senza modificare Rhino.
Si chiamano punti di controllo perchè servono a controllare la forma della curva. Per controllare sia la forma che l’intersezione con altre curve si usano strategie che includono la costruzione di geometrie di appoggio.
Le curve non passano dai punti di controllo “interni” a meno che questi non siano dei kink oppure se si parla di curve di grado 1.

No. Non sarebbe nessun vantaggio. Una modifica di questo tipo sputtanerebbe la curvatura in modo inaccettabile. Ovvero non considererebbe minimamente il conservare la qualità della curvatura che è il punto di partenza di qualunque curva che debba avere un senso.

okay okay non ti aaaaaarrabbiare
ciao
M

non mi arrabbio mai…:rofl:
ci mancherebbe!